After digging online and scraping through the DAZ forums for information (specifically those topics dealing with Filament and the use of Filatoon Shaders) I'm fairly certain that with a little elbow grease and the right settings, it's possible to get output renders similiar to the Fortiche Production Studio style of cel shading seen in Netflix's Arcane series (screenshots attached). 

From a technical perspective (if anyone knows) would the Arcane output depend more on the handpainting of the skin textures or something on the Filatoon Shader side (or maybe even a geoshell thing).  I mean, it's probably both, but I think the hand-painted look of the textures when used on the skin probably push it forward more as opposed to just the Filatoon shaders. You can see the light/darkness sharpness painted onto the skin textures especially around the nose and eyes that is consistent with all characters in that animated series.

I know there are a couple of products in the DAZ store that have Filatoon textures that bring render output close to this, but they are for Genesis 9 and I work with G8 mostly, so I was planning on experimenting with my own hand-painted textures for Genesis 8.  Anyone tried to do this yet--any thoughts from anyone with experience with Filatoon?
